Output fa3aa8e5abfa6e19a18f2c6f4371b3f6587ecc31cf3c52cfb78522cecb71632d:1

value
987092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0de279bec65c7d8dd46f86876322005f8c586f OP_EQUAL
address
3LZpRyb2MB15bsFfEzJxHGeXE4MXNiyYM6
transaction
fa3aa8e5abfa6e19a18f2c6f4371b3f6587ecc31cf3c52cfb78522cecb71632d
confirmations
346524
spent
true